Fitness Boot Camps Outshine Fitness Instructors
Fitness bootcamp trainers are on the rise as boot camps spread across America. Who are these fitness bootcamp trainers and just how do they compare to the trainers one can find at your local gym?
The backgrounds of fitness boot camp trainers can vary greatly from company to company, even so it appears the most effective boot camp companies in the US like this prominent Boston boot camp recruits trainers with group training skills from gyms. These bootcamps attract trainers with 3 to 8 years of group physical fitness training experience.
Giving group classes ensures that trainers that teach at boot camps are aware of every one of the clients exercise forms from start to finish. The personalities of group teachers are very different from the everyday fitness instructor in the gym. Bootcamp trainers will almost always be high energy, excited, and almost animated to help keep the groups attention. It is believed that to become a group trainer, a catchy personality is important to people wanting to take the class.
